AAST 225

Race, Inequality & Education

Catalog description

Offered intermittently. This seminar-style honors course revolves around the question, "What is the relationship between racial inequality and education?" and explores how school systems in the United States have perpetuated racial inequality, while also considering if and how schools could instead work to combat racial inequality.
